Extended Instantaneous Protection (EIP) allows the WL circuit breaker to be applied at the withstand rating of
2
the circuit breaker with minus 0% tolerance; this means there is no instantaneous override at all. EIP further
enables the circuit breaker to be applied up to the full instantaneous rating of the circuit breaker in systems
where the available fault current exceeds the withstand rating.
